A gerontologic nurse is analyzing the data from a patients focused respiratory assessment. The nurse is aware that the amount of respiratory dead space increases with age. What is the effect of this physiological change?

  • A. Increased diffusion of gases
  • B. Decreased diffusion capacity for oxygen
  • C. Decreased shunting of blood
  • D. Increased ventilation
Correct Answer: B

Rationale: The amount of respiratory dead space increases with age. Combined with other changes, this results in a decreased diffusion capacity for oxygen with increasing age, producing lower oxygen levels in the arterial circulation. Decreased shunting and increased ventilation do not occur with age.
